Intralinks appoint Ian Turner as UK Country Manager

23 May 2011

IntraLinks Inc. a leading provider of critical information exchange solutions has appointed Ian Turner as UK Country Manager. Ian joins Intralinks from Kofax where he held the position of Director of Software and Solution Sales for UK and Ireland. He was previously at Nuance as General Manager for Northern Europe, Middle East and Africa.

CloudPay appoint Tim O’Donoghue as CTO

19 April 2011

CloudPay, providers of multi-national Saas-based payroll solutions have appointed Tim O’Donoghue as CTO. Tim joins CloudPay from Sungard where he held the position of CTO.  Previously Tim was Head of Engineering International for Yahoo! and Head of Development at Misys.
